To determine whether buying a boat and a boat trailer are independent events, we need to check if the probability of buying a boat trailer changes if we know whether or not a boat has been bought.
Let's use the formula for conditional probability to calculate the probability of buying a boat trailer given that a boat has been bought:
P(trailer | boat) = P(trailer and boat) / P(boat)
We are given that P(trailer and boat) = 44%, P(boat) = 62%, and we can calculate P(trailer) using the probability of the complement:
P(trailer) = 1 - P(no trailer) = 1 - 0.55 = 0.45
Substituting these values, we get:
P(trailer | boat) = 0.44 / 0.62 ≈ 0.71
This means that if a boat has been bought, the probability of buying a boat trailer is about 71%.
Now, we can compare this conditional probability to the marginal probability of buying a boat trailer without considering whether or not a boat has been bought. If the conditional probability is the same as the marginal probability, then buying a boat and a boat trailer are independent events.
P(trailer) = 0.45
Since P(trailer | boat) ≠ P(trailer), we can conclude that buying a boat and a boat trailer are dependent events. The probability of buying a boat trailer changes depending on whether or not a boat has been bought.

For each function, determine whether y varies directly with x . If so, identify the constant of variation.
4 y-7 x=0
The function is 4y - 7x = 0.
We need to determine whether y varies directly with x. If so, we need to identify the constant of variation.
What is direct variation?
Direct variation is a relationship between two variables in which one variable is a constant multiple of the other variable. This constant multiple is called the constant of variation.
Let's put the given function in the form of y = kx + b, where k is the constant of variation and b is the y-intercept.
4y - 7x = 0
=> 4y = 7x
=> y = (7/4)x
This function is in the form of y = kx, where k = 7/4.
Therefore, we can say that y varies directly with x, and the constant of variation is 7/4.

A triangular prism is 11.2 meters long and has a triangular face with a base of 11 meters and
a height of 11 meters. What is the volume of the triangular prism?
cubic meters
Answer:
The volume of the triangular prism is 677.6 cubic meters.
Step-by-step explanation:
The formula for the volume of a triangular prism is:
\(\sf\qquad\dashrightarrow Volume \: (V) = \dfrac{1}{2} \times b\times h \times l \)
where:
b is the base of the triangular faceh is the height of the triangular facel is the length of the prismSubstituting the given values, we have:
\(\sf:\implies Volume \: (V) = \dfrac{1}{2} \times 11 \times 11 \times 11.2\)
\(\sf:\implies \boxed{\bold{\:\:Volume \: (V) = 677.6\: meters^3\:\:}}\:\:\:\green{\checkmark}\)
Therefore, the volume of the triangular prism is 677.6 cubic meters.

Reading a list of data and answering questions related to comparisons, percentages, and proportions involves analyzing the given information and calculating relevant metrics based on the data.
To determine "how many more" or the difference between two values, you subtract one value from the other. For example, if you are comparing the sales of two products, you can subtract the sales of one product from the other to find the difference in sales.
To calculate "what percentage of" a specific value, you divide the specific value by the total and multiply it by 100. This will give you the percentage. For instance, if you want to find the percentage of customers who rated a product positively out of the total number of customers, you divide the number of positive ratings by the total number of customers and multiply it by 100.
To determine "what proportion of" a group falls into a specific category, you divide the number of individuals in that category by the total number of individuals in the group. This will give you the proportion. For example, if you want to find the proportion of customers who prefer a certain brand out of the total number of customers surveyed, you divide the number of customers preferring that brand by the total number of customers.
By applying these calculations to the given data, you can provide accurate answers to questions regarding comparisons, percentages, and proportions.
